Hepburn Developed for: Interior Health Submitted by: CHolmes Contact Email: simulation@interiorhealth.ca Peer Reviewed: No (Has not been peer reviewed or the information will be provided later) Scenario Information Case Summary: 59 y.o. male presents to ER with an episode of syncope when he went to let his dog outside. He turned around and took a step then doesn’t recall anything until he awoke on the floor. Abrasion to face. No other symptoms. No warning. Previously well. Only history is a remote back surgery. No medications.
